Bob Stowe is the City Manager for the City of Bothell, a position he has held since January 2005. Bothell has a population of over 33,000 residents and a business population of approximately 25,000. Bob is the chief executive officer of a full service city with a 2013-2014 budget of $224 million and 300 employees. Before arriving in Bothell, Bob was the City Manager for the City of Mill Creek, WA for nine years and held other top administrator positions for two other Washington cities for an additional 10 years. Bob enjoys a reputation as a progressive and talented municipal manager, bringing stability and leadership to the cities he has served over the last 27 years in Washington State. Bob is a past president of the Washington City/County Management Association (2002-2003) and holds a bachelor’s degree in Urban and Regional Planning from Eastern Washington University and a MBA from Seattle University.

Bob Lavigna, author of Engaging Government Employees (American Management Association) is Director of the Institute for Public Sector Employee Engagement, a division of CPS HR Services, an independent government agency. The Institute is dedicated to helping public sector and nonprofit organizations measure and improve employee engagementBefore joining the Institute, Bob was Assistant Vice Chancellor and Director of HR for the University of Wisconsin. His previous positions also include Vice President- Research for the Partnership for Public Service and Director of the Wisconsin civil service system. Bob began his career with the U.S. Government Accountability Office.He is an elected Fellow of the National Academy of Public Administration and was selected as a “Public Official of the Year” by Governing magazine. Bob has a B.A. in public affairs from George Washington University and an M.S. in HR from Cornell University.
